See him on the store shelf? Up up and into the cart,
This review is from: Fisher-Price Sesame Street Up, Up Elmo (Toy)
We bought our son this at age 28 months. He'd never had a lovey or a blankie or a pacifier or any other of those typical comfort things. Weird, huh?? We thought so too. But as soon as this Elmo was out of the box... he became a part of the family. He ever wants him in the bath. Easy on batteries and a truly adorable toy. It has sensors or something so it actually interacts w/ the child... seems like Elmo is literally talking right to you. Reasonably priced and well worth it

4.0 out of 5 stars
Great Elmo toy,
By tinabtw (Northridge, CA)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Fisher-Price Sesame Street Up, Up Elmo (Toy)
My son loves this Elmo. He got it for his first birthday because I fell in love with it in the store. The voice, phrases and songs are so cute without being overly obnoxious (as I find TMX to be). I knocked off a star because, as the previous reviewer said, it isn't soft. You can definitely feel the mechanics and voicebox beneath the fur. However, I did not purchase this toy for it to be a 'lovey' or for my son to sleep with, so I really don't mind that. I bought it as a toy for him to play with - which it excels at.
